              • Re: Diemaco L119A1 SFW

                Bit complicated haha!

                Brought the gun with a TA31 off the forums for £200. Then sold like the spare RIS, Barrel reciever, PEQ Box + Battery it came with for £70. Then got a Pro Arms Outer Barrel for £50 for HK. Swapped the TA31 for a TA01. Brought CA Rail covers for a £10. Stock pad £12.50 and stock £10 off the forums. New rear wired GB off the bay for £28. New pistol grip £10 off the forums. Element red Hop up £10 (I think?) + Guarder hop+bucking £6. New front sight + Gas tube and ares hanguard ring £10
                Total:
                130 +45+10+10+12.50+28 +10+10+6+10
                = £271.

                Plus remember I didnt need a new GB but wanted one, and it still functions fine with the old one. Pistol grip was nescarry but stipped a screw (hence the cut) so im replacing that.

                Suppose I got lucky :D
